What is Thor Energy FCF Margin %?

FCF Margin % is calculated as Free Cash Flow divided by its Revenue. Thor Energy's Free Cash Flow for the six months ended in Dec. 2023 was $-1.46 Mil. Thor Energy's Revenue for the six months ended in Dec. 2023 was $0.00 Mil. Therefore, Thor Energy's FCF Margin %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.00%.

As of today, Thor Energy's current FCF Yield % is -67.96%.

Thor Energy FCF Margin % Calculation

FCF margin is the ratio of Free Cash Flow div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Thor Energy's FCF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2023 is calculated as

FCF Margin=Free Cash Flow (A: Jun. 2023 )/Revenue (A: Jun. 2023 )
=-2.914/0
= %

Thor Energy PLC is a uranium and energy metals resource company. It is focused on uranium and energy metals that are crucial in the shift to a green energy economy. Thor has prospective projects that give exposure to uranium, nickel, copper, lithium and gold minerals. The group's projects are located in Australia and the USA.
